    Re: looking for a cheap cnc router to attempt to learn on.

    I'd say get theTaig now and save the money you'd waste on the piece-of-junk router. Those things often just don't work, which discourages people about the whole CNC thing. You can learn on a Taig just as well, and it would do everything you say you want to do: make lures out of wood or molds out of aluminum.

    Re: looking for a cheap cnc router to attempt to learn on.

    The Taig isn't as fast as some machines, but it's not all that slow. And with a small part, you don't really need to go very fast. If you decide to go into production with these little wooden lures, you might decide to get a faster machine for that. In the meantime, you can make them and the molds you need on the Taig, and learn about the process as you go.
